CNGI -China Next Generation Internet project
•• Initiated in 2002, it is one of the efforts to address the future Internet issue, approved by Initiated in 2002, it is one of the efforts to address the future Internet issue, approved by government in 2003government in 2003
•• Leaded by National Reform and Development Committee, 170M USD equivalentLeaded by National Reform and Development Committee, 170M USD equivalent
•• Joint with MST, MOE,CAS, MII ,NSFC,CAE, …Joint with MST, MOE,CAS, MII ,NSFC,CAE, …
•• Main objectivesMain objectives
•• Research project on next generation technologiesResearch project on next generation technologies
•• CNGI Backbone: nation wide, 40 Giga POPs and 300 campus networks, international linkageCNGI Backbone: nation wide, 40 Giga POPs and 300 campus networks, international linkage
•• Build advanced applicationsBuild advanced applications
•• Transfer successful results to information industryTransfer successful results to information industry
•• HuaweiHuawei, , RuijieRuijie Networks and other manufactures delivered IPv6 enabled network productsNetworks and other manufactures delivered IPv6 enabled network products
•• All NSPs have involved in this projectAll NSPs have involved in this project
•• CERNET, China Telecom and other national Internet service providersCERNET, China Telecom and other national Internet service providers
•• In 21 Feb. Government setup a clear goal to promote IPv6 for next generation InternetIn 21 Feb. Government setup a clear goal to promote IPv6 for next generation Internet《《国务院关于培育和发展战略性新兴产业的决定国务院关于培育和发展战略性新兴产业的决定》》

Traffic report from 6NOC of CNGI-CERNET2• More than 400 Universities built their IPv6 enabled campus
network
• CNGI-CERNT2 backbone traffic keeps increasing
• 68Gbps in Peak hour
• 22Gbps in average
• 780/48 IPv6 address block allocated
• 4092 DNS AAAA records

v6Speed: A BT program supports VoD• A full-featured BitTorrent
client based on qBittorrent, libtorrent-rasterbar library and Qt4
• IPv6 compliant
• Provide HTTP gateway for VLC to play the torrent file
• Start to play 720P video torrent in 8s
北京邮电大学
v6Speed:Download policy
• Need all data, order does not matter
• Download rarest pieces first• It’s what others need• Increases data availability
• Download pieces in parallel
• Verify data using hashes• Included in torrent file
In order
New policy
北京邮电大学
v6Speed:Download policy changes
• Download in sequential order, get one piece from one peer
• When playback position has new data, get this urgency piece from all peers which have the pieces
